]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
Fix a da(4) driver memory leak for SCSI SMR devices.
authorKenneth D. Merry <ken@FreeBSD.org>
Mon, 1 Oct 2018 19:00:46 +0000 (19:00 +0000)
committerKenneth D. Merry <ken@FreeBSD.org>
Mon, 1 Oct 2018 19:00:46 +0000 (19:00 +0000)
commitaabac0c17673904e13947cc621c65898e74c3e43
tree0342944d687cef2c3db13b5b1dd464db6957ea6e
parent93db904d19dc7d7f0f66439c43bc3558b2fdcb01
Fix a da(4) driver memory leak for SCSI SMR devices.

In the probe case for SCSI SMR Host Aware or Most Managed drives, be sure
to free allocated memory.

sys/cam/scsi/scsi_da.c:
In dadone_probezone(), free the data pointer before returning.

MFC after: 3 days
Sponsored by: Spectra Logic
Approved by: re (kib)
sys/cam/scsi/scsi_da.c